| You teach reading literacy. How about economic literacy at the same time? This curriculum is written with an interdisciplinary approach so you can teach economic concepts within the language arts curriculum.
- 15 lesson plans: 7 for grades K-3 and 8 for grades 4-6
- Uses both fiction and nonfiction books
- Easy to use plans teach scarcity, resources, interest, investment in human capital, specialization, barter and more
- No economics background required
- All lessons incorporate learning-by-doing, so you and your students will have fun
